External Event Requests

Thank you for your interest in hosting your meeting, seminar, or event at WSU Spokane. 

Before making your request, you must have a current WSU Spokane sponsor and a connection to the health sciences and/or the WSU Spokane mission. If you have a current connection to the campus, please fill out the form below. The Scheduling team will contact you upon receipt of the request.

All events are subject to review.

All events are subject to executive review and will only be scheduled if deemed possible by all campus partners involved with your specific event setup.

Staffing reductions

Due to staffing reductions, event support services on campus are currently limited. External event organizers are asked to work with a WSU Spokane employee sponsor who can assist with event logistics, setup and cleanup, and be on-site during the event. The WSU Spokane employee sponsor should be aware of your request prior to submitting your inquiry.

10th Day Policy

Events that are not academic in nature are subject to WSU’s 10th Day policy and will not be scheduled until the 10th day of the respective academic term. If an event falls within the first 10 days, it will be scheduled no later than the night prior at 5 PM.

This policy is a reflection of the Washington Administrative Code (WAC), which stipulates that classes must be prioritized in academic spaces. You can contact Academic Scheduling with questions regarding this policy.

Fees

Administrative Fee

All reservations will be charged a $50 administrative fee.

Facilities and Custodial Fees

Extra charges

Events that place a substantial amount of trash, use of energy, or custodial supplies will have charges passed onto the user.

  • Set-up and custodial for events during normal working hours: $125
  • Set-up and custodial for events after hours and weekends: $175

IT Support Fees

IT Support may be available for your event. Please work with the Event Scheduler to learn more. Additional fees may be charged.

Cancellation Fees

Cancellation by the TENANT within thirty days of the reservation will result in a ten percent cancellation fee. Additionally, labor charges will be applied if WSU Health Sciences Spokane staff have set-up the event. If a reservation is cancelled less than three business days before utilization is scheduled to take place, WSU Health Sciences Spokane reserves the right to retain all use fees.

If for any reason WSU Health Sciences Spokane is required to relocate the scheduled event, the institution will do all that is possible to allocate alternative space, located on campus, in order to fulfill the TENANT’S needs.
